В любой области деятельности возникают неоднозначные решения, вызывающие споры в интернете. В сфере информационных технологий такие разногласия также присутствуют. В Beeline Cloud решили вспомнить некоторые из них.
Одним из вечных вопросов является выбор между camelCase и snake_case. Сторонники первого утверждают, что этот стиль удобнее для длинных выражений, в то время как приверженцы второго акцентируют внимание на легкости восприятия переменных с подчеркиваниями. Исследования показывают, что разница в читаемости между ними минимальна.
Следующий актуальный вопрос касается низкокодовых платформ. Ранее считалось, что они смогут сократить число программистов, но с течением времени интерес к ним поутих. Многие компании обнаружили, что такие решения требуют доработок и участия профессионалов.
Наконец, микросервисы, которые стали популярны несколько лет назад, также не обошлись без критики. Некоторые эксперты предостерегают от их использования без должного планирования, подчеркивая, что это может привести к новым проблемам.
Таким образом, в ИТ-сообществе продолжаются обсуждения, и порой предпочтения зависят от личных вкусов и опыта разработчиков.
tasani.ru